【实际项目精选源码】ehr人力资源管理系统实现案例(java,vue)

一、项目介绍

00abc4a455cf39b9c46aca358a5c1b3c.png

一款全源码可二开,可基于云部署、私有部署的企业级数字化人力资源管理系统,涵盖了招聘、人事、考勤、绩效、社保、酬薪六大模块,解决了从人事招聘到酬薪计算的全周期人力资源管理,符合当下大中小型企业组织架构管理运作模式,助力企业人力资源管控信息化、智能化、规范化,为企业核心竞争力的提升不断赋能,做到降本增效。本系统为行业通用版,适用各类企业。

fc0ab848c4a8f496a9b89b8b4e518bd8.png

二、项目技术介绍

前端:Vue

后端:Springboot+mybatis+mysql+redis

项目前后端分离技术开发,部署简单,轻松落地,也可对接企业各大信息化平台,做到互联互通,构成一体化生态健康持续发展。

三、项目六大核心功能

(一)、招聘模块

 

26ccc302140a87b735cb210993a427fd.png

 

7ffcba632b0b73373ba1046a0937ea9a.png

此模块主要是为企业的招聘管理过程提供支持。招聘专员可以通过该模块完成相应招聘岗位发布、简历投递、简历筛选、多轮面试考核、是否淘汰、是否进入录用阶段等各种招聘流程的管理工作,支持简历自动化识别,上传PDF或者Word格式的简历,系统可根据智能化算法提取到相应字段到表单中。同时还可以对求职者的信息进行整合、分析,从而更好地为企业或组织招聘工作提供决策支持。

(二)、组织和人事管理模块

 

c75fc6bffb1c15d412c8d8d5fd85bb61.png

组织管理和人事管理是eHR系统最基础、也是最重要的的功能模块之一,为企业或组织提供组织架构管理、部门设置、职位管理、员工个人信息维护等服务,包括员工档案、入职离职管理、合同续签、转正管理、员工台账等内容。

(三)、考勤管理模块

 

2c3ef3ef9d258fda69639b1ccc0fdd7d.png

考勤模块主要是为企业的员工考勤管理提供支持,系统支持同步钉钉考勤打卡情况,也支持Excel考勤数据明细的导入,以月度考勤为单位计算,最后考勤情况可同步到酬薪计算管理,实现酬薪计算自动化,帮助企业实现全面的考勤管理。

(四)、绩效考核模块

 

53455c39ea2aacd9741a0f31a882ff10.png

绩效考核模块主要是为企业或组织的绩效考核管理过程提供支持。管理员可通过此模块完成绩效指标设定、绩效计划制定、绩效评估、绩效审核、绩效沟通等各种绩效管理工作,对于酬薪和绩效考核挂钩的员工,可每个月制定考核计划,最后根据考核分数是否达标自动化推送到酬薪管理。同时还可以对员工的绩效表现、绩效评估结果等信息进行管理,从而更好地激励员工的积极性和创造力。

(五)、社保管理模块

 

b50fc9923806654f5d47e8a96cd428e7.png

 

ff2cde7cc1793fc6b357df8608cdf292.png

社保管理模块是为企业的社保、公积金管理过程提供支持。系统可根据不同的岗位、职级设定多套社保方案,每个员工绑定一个社保方案,管理员可查看到每个月整个企业的参保人数、社保总费用、公积金总费用等,对于已经离职的员工,可以进行停保操作。最终计算好核对之后,可以自动化讲社保信息同步到本月的酬薪管理计划。

(六)、薪酬管理模块

 

75ad2cd28af66722e5da3ceb1cd30524.png

酬薪管理模块主要是为企业或组织的薪酬管理过程提供支持。该模块包括薪酬核算、社保公积金缴纳、奖惩考核等内容,管理员可以通过该模块完成员工工资、福利、补贴等各种薪酬管理工作,系统支持一键导出工资条,也支持以邮件的方式直接发送工资条给员工。同时还可以对员工收入、福利、纳税等信息进行维护和统计,从而更好地保障员工的利益和公司的经济效益。

四、项目资料

eHR系统的功能模块应用非常广泛,可以帮助企业或组织实现从招聘、培训、绩效考核到薪酬管理等管理流程的高效、便捷、精细化。因此,对于企业或组织来说,选择一款适用的人力资源管理系统,是提高管理效率、优化组织管理的重要手段之一。

系统源代码获取:Q+3588019357。

 

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.rhkb.cn/news/331609.html

如若内容造成侵权/违法违规/事实不符,请联系长河编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

List Control控件绑定变量

创建基于对话框的mfc项目 添加 List Control控件 右击控件,选择“添加变量” 在初始化对话框代码中增加一些代码 BOOL CMFCApplication3Dlg::OnInitDialog() { //...// TODO: 在此添加额外的初始化代码DWORD dwStyle m_programLangList.GetExtendedStyle(); …

用户态下屏蔽全局消息钩子 —— ClientLoadLibrary 指针覆盖

目录 前言 一、研究 SetWindowsHookEx 的机制 二、概念验证 三、运行效果分析 四、总结与展望 参考文献 原文出处链接:[https://blog.csdn.net/qq_59075481/article/details/139206017] 前言 SetWindowsHookEx 函数帮助其他人员注入模块到我们的进程&#x…

PHP质量工具系列之php_CodeSniffer

PHP_CodeSniffer 是一组两个 PHP 脚本:主脚本 phpcs 对 PHP、JavaScript 和 CSS 文件进行标记,以检测是否违反定义的编码标准;第二个脚本 phpcbf 自动纠正违反编码标准的行为。PHP_CodeSniffer 是一个重要的开发工具,可以确保你的…

二叉树—先后序线索化和先后序线索遍历

有了上篇文章的基础,先序和后序的线索化逻辑一样。 代码如下: void preOrderThreadTree(TreeNode* T,TreeNode** pre) {if (T NULL) {;}else {//printf("%c ", T->val);if (T->lchild NULL) {T->ltag 1;T->lchild *pre;}if …

翻译《The Old New Thing》- What‘s the deal with the EM_SETHILITE message?

Whats the deal with the EM_SETHILITE message? - The Old New Thing (microsoft.com)https://devblogs.microsoft.com/oldnewthing/20071025-00/?p24693 Raymond Chen 2007年10月25日 简要 文章讨论了EM_SETHILITE和EM_GETHILITE消息在文档中显示为“未实现”的原因。这些…

Python数字比大小获取大的数

目录 一、引言 二、数字比较的基本语法 三、获取较大的数 使用条件语句 使用内置函数 四、处理特殊情况 比较非数字类型 处理无穷大和NaN 五、应用实例 在游戏开发中比较分数 在数据分析中找出最大值 六、优化与性能 七、总结 一、引言 在Python编程的广阔天地中…

Redis 性能管理

一、Redis 性能管理 #查看Redis内存使用 172.168.1.11:6379> info memory 1. 内存碎片率 操作系统分配的内存值 used_memory_rss 除以 Redis 使用的内存总量值 used_memory 计算得出。内存值 used_memory_rss 表示该进程所占物理内存的大小,即为操作系统分配给…

【qt】纯代码界面设计

界面设计目录 一.界面设计的三种方式1.使用界面设计器2.纯代码界面设计3.混合界面设计 二.纯代码进行界面设计1.代码界面设计的总思路2.创建项目3.设计草图4.添加组件指针5.初始化组件指针6.添加组件到窗口①水平布局②垂直布局③细节点 7.定义槽函数8.初始化信号槽9.实现槽函数…

Sam Altman微软Build 2024最新演讲:AI可能是下一个移动互联网

大家好,我是木易,一个持续关注AI领域的互联网技术产品经理,国内Top2本科,美国Top10 CS研究生,MBA。我坚信AI是普通人变强的“外挂”,所以创建了“AI信息Gap”这个公众号,专注于分享AI全维度知识…

Tomcat部署项目的方式

目录 1、Tomcat发布项目的方式 方式1: 直接把项目发布到webapps目录下 方式2:项目发布到ROOT目录 方式3:虚拟路径方式发布项目 方式4:(推荐)虚拟路径,另外的方式! 方式5:发布多个网站 1、…

无界鼠标与键盘,如何轻松控制多台电脑

简介 在软件开发领域,高效地管理多台电脑是至关重要的。Mouse without Borders软件为开发人员提供了一种便捷的解决方案,使他们能够轻松地在多台电脑之间共享鼠标和键盘。不仅如此,Mouse without Borders还提供了许多高级功能,如…

STM32F1之OV7725摄像头

目录 1. 摄像头简介 2. OV7725 摄像头简介 3. OV7725 引脚 4. OV7725 功能框架图 5. SCCB时序 5.1 SCCB 的起始、停止信号及数据有效性 5.2 SCCB 数据读写过程 1. 摄像头简介 在各类信息中,图像含有最丰富的信息,作为机…

谈谈你对 vue 的理解 ?

1.谈谈你对 vue 的理解 ? 官方: Vue是一套用于构建用户界面的渐进式框架,Vue 的核心库只关注视图层 2. 声明式框架 Vue 的核心特点,用起来简单。那我们就有必要知道命令式和声明式的区别! 早在 JQ 的时代编写的代码都是命令式的,命令式框架重要特点就是关注过程 声明…

world machine学习笔记(3)

打开 可以打开场景设置,项目设置平铺构建设置 场景设置: 输出范围 设置中心点和范围 设置分辨率 项目设置: 设置地图颜色,单位,最高地形高度 点击这个图形进行预览设置 该按钮还有其他的功能 world machine基础流程…

LeetCode算法题:42. 接雨水(Java)

题目描述 给定 n 个非负整数表示每个宽度为 1 的柱子的高度图,计算按此排列的柱子,下雨之后能接多少雨水。 示例 1: 输入:height [0,1,0,2,1,0,1,3,2,1,2,1] 输出:6 解释:上面是由数组 [0,1,0,2,1,0,1,3…

分享一个用AI降本的思路,不懂代码也能上手

如何用AI解决实际的业务问题? 生财圈友我来利用ChatGPT做算法建模,每年为公司省下6万元。 今天他将分享通过ChatGPT进行数据分析的思路,从最开始定义问题到最终数据论证。 上手的实操过程门槛并不高,但可以实现把官方电商平台的…

huggingface笔记: accelerate estimate-memory 命令

探索可用于某一机器的潜在模型时,了解模型的大小以及它是否适合当前显卡的内存是一个非常复杂的问题。为了缓解这个问题,Accelerate 提供了一个 命令行命令 accelerate estimate-memory。 accelerate estimate-memory {MODEL_NAME} --library_name {LIBR…

Ubuntu22.04虚拟机设置静态IP

虚拟机设置静态IP 按下电脑的 “win”键,在弹出的输入框中输入“控制面板”,选中控制面板 1.选择 “网络和Internet” 2.选择 “网络和共享中心” 3.选择 “更改适配器设置” 4.选择 “VMnet8”,双击打开 5.选择 “属性” 找到 “Internet …

Reactor设计模式

Reactor设计模式 Reactor模式称为反应器模式或应答者模式,是基于事件驱动的设计模式,拥有一个或多个并发输入源,有一个服务处理器和多个请求处理器,服务处理器会同步的将输入的请求事件以多路复用的方式分发给相应的请求处理器。…

Qt 界面上字体自适应控件大小 - 随控件缩放

Qt 界面上字体自适应控件大小 - 随控件缩放 引言一、设计思路二、进阶版大致思路三、参考链接 引言 Qt控件自适应字体大小可以用adjustSize()函数,但字体自适应控件大小并没有现成的函数可调. - 本文实现了按钮上的字体随按钮大小变化而变化 (如上图所示) - 其他控件…